Use the following information to answer the next 12 exercises: The U.S. Center for Disease Control reports that the mean life expectancy was 47.6 years for whites born in 1900 and 33.0 years for nonwhites. Suppose that you randomly survey death records for people born in 1900 in a certain county. Of the 124 whites, the mean life span was 45.3 years with a standard deviation of 12.7 years. Of the 82 nonwhites, the mean life span was 34.1 years with a standard deviation of 15.6 years. Conduct a hypothesis test to see if the mean life spans in the county were the same for whites and nonwhites.

Calculate the test statistic and p-value.

Calculate the test statistic and p-value.

Consider the provided information, sample mean life span of whites x¯1=45.3years with sample standard deviation s1=12.7years, sample mean life span of non-whites x¯2=34.1years with sample standard deviation s2=15.6years, sample size of whites n1=124and sample size of non-whites n2=82. The test is two-tailed.

The test statistic and the p-value can be calculated using the TI-83 calculator.

Now to test the difference in the means, follow the steps given below:

Step 1: Press STAT and use the arrow ()to TESTS.

Step 2: Now press the arrow ()to 4:2-SampTTest and press enter.

Step 3: Then use the arrow ()to STATS and press enter.

Step 4: Now press the arrow ()and enter the inputs as shown below,

Step 5: Then press the arrow ()to calculator and press enter. The output is given below,

From the above output, it can be observed that, the test statistic value is 5.421and the ρ-value is 0.000000234.
